    Title/Author: Combat leader to corporate leader/ Chad Storlie.
    Reminder of title: 20 lessons to advance your civilian career /
    Author: Storlie, Chad.
    Published: Santa Barbara, Calif. :Praeger, : c2010.,
    Description: xiii, 184 p. :ill. ;25 cm.
    [NT 15003449]: Preface : the military veteran and re-entering the civilian world -- Veteran lesson 1 : veterans building businesses, employees, and themselves for commercial success -- Veteran lesson 2 : military ethics and values form the foundation for business success -- Veteran lesson 3 : maintain a personal improvement plan -- Veteran lesson 4 : build networks of experts -- Veteran lesson 5 : overcome common mistakes veterans make in the workplace -- Veteran lesson 6 : create a periodic corporate intelligence report -- Veteran lesson 7 : understand your company's mission statement -- Veteran lesson 8 : use the war game process -- Veteran lesson 9 : use the military synchronization matrix -- Veteran lesson 10 : employ risk mitigation -- Veteran lesson 11 : employ standard operating procedures (SOPs) -- Veteran lesson 12 : back-up plans to ensure success -- Veteran lesson 13 : create and lead powerful teams -- Veteran lesson 14 : use military crisis-management techniques -- Veteran lesson 15 : prepare an exit strategy -- Veteran lesson 16 : use the military after-action review -- Veteran lesson 17 : employ counseling sessions -- Veteran lesson 18 : position yourself for promotion -- Veteran lesson 19: use mentoring for career improvement -- Veteran lesson 20 : adapt military tools to commercial business applications -- Summary : the 20 lessons that bring the greatest value to your company and career.
